472 F.3d 599

UNITED STATES of America, Plaintiff-Appellee,
v.
Luis Emilo GONZALES, Defendant-Appellant.

No. 04-30007.

United States Court of Appeals, Ninth Circuit.

December 21, 2006.

Elizabeth A. Olson, Esq., U.S. Department of Justice, Civil Division/Appellate Staff, Washington, DC, for Plaintiff-Appellee.

Anne Walstrom, Esq., Federal Defenders of Eastern Washington & Idaho, Yakima, WA, Tracy A. Staab, Esq., Federal Public Defender's Office (Eastern Washington & Idaho), Spokane, WA, for Defendant-Appellant.

Before MARY M. SCHROEDER, Chief Judge.

ORDER

Upon the vote of a majority of nonrecused regular active judges of this court, it is ordered that this case be reheard by the en banc court pursuant to Circuit Rule 35-3.
